Adding 'open' did the job but getting /etc/sysconfig/network/ifcfg-wlan setup properly seems to be a problem.
I can get on the internet when I run the above command line.
I deleted the /etc/sysconfig/network/ifcfg-wlan to regenerate a new one through Yast but yast won't let me, because it say's Error: Hardware configuration bus-pci-0000:02:03.0 already exist Choose a different one , I can't go any further inYast to generate a new /etc/sysconfig/network/ifcfg-wlan file.


Here is my config file adopted to your parameters.  You could try that

BOOTPROTO='dhcp'
MTU=''
REMOTE_IPADDR=''
STARTMODE='onboot'
NAME='Intel PRO/Wireless LAN 2100 3B Mini PCI Adapter'
UNIQUE='JNkJ.x2u1_foDyv7'
USERCONTROL='yes'
WIRELESS_AP='2WIRE783'
WIRELESS_AUTH_MODE='open'
WIRELESS_BITRATE='auto'
WIRELESS_CHANNEL='6'
WIRELESS_DEFAULT_KEY='0'
WIRELESS_ESSID='2WIRE782'
WIRELESS_FREQUENCY=''
WIRELESS_KEY=''
WIRELESS_KEY_0='8956231064 open'
WIRELESS_KEY_1=''
WIRELESS_KEY_2=''
WIRELESS_KEY_3=''
WIRELESS_KEY_LENGTH='128'
WIRELESS_MODE='Managed'
WIRELESS_NICK=''
WIRELESS_NWID=''
WIRELESS_POWER='yes'
WIRELESS_WPA_PSK=''
_nm_name='bus-pci-0000:02:03.0'
